About Baddi Tehsil

Baddi is a tehsil in district of Solan , Himachal Pradesh , India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Baddi was 90,942 which includes 52,308 males and 38,634 females. Baddi covers 232 Km2 area.

Urban/Rural Population of Baddi

DESCRIPTION VALUE DESCRIPTION VALUE
Urban Population 29,911 Rural Population 61,031
Urban male Population 19,332 Rural Male Population 32,976
Urban Female Population 10,579 Rural Female Population 28,055

This table provides a detailed breakdown of the urban and rural population of Baddi. The Baddi urban population is 29,911 with 19,332 male population and 10,579 female population. In contrast Baddi rural population is 61,031, comprising 32,976 male population and 28,055 female population.
